1. As of now, Starhub is probably the best if you want to leave Singtel.

5Gbps Broadband @$29.55/mth
- 1x Free TP-Link HB710 WiFi 7 router
- Free $100 Shopping Vouchers -- upgraded to S$150 vouchers.

10Gbps Broadband @$44.49/mth
-1x Free TP-Link EB810v WiFi 7 router
- Free $250 Shopping Vouchers

10Gbps Broadband @$33.59/mth
-1x Free TP-Link HB710 WiFi 7 router
-No Voucher

Installation and activation fess waived
*24 months contract

2. M1 is another good choice, but M1 has increased the price of 6Gbps plan by quite a bit.

M1 10Gbps without router, physical shop offer at S$30.90 per month
M1 6Gbps with TP-Link Archer BE805 or Asus RT-BE92U, at S$38.90 per month (price increased from S$34.90 per month in early 2025)
M1 3Gbps with TP-Link Archer BE230 or Asus RT-BE58U, at S$32.90 per month (price increased from S$29.90 per month in early 2025)

so if i want to terminate singtel and sign new fibre plan with other provider, do i sign the new fibre first then do cancellation for singtel or cancel first ?
for me i signup new plan first from other provider... because it will take a few days for them to arrange their technical person to setup at your house... i would suggest u to signup new ISP 3 weeks before your next singtel billing cycle...
